This year we asked respondents regarding their choices for text, audio and video clip when eating information online. Generally, we find that the bulk still choose to review the news (57%), instead than watch (30%) or pay attention to it (13%), but more youthful people (under-35s) are most likely to listen (17%) than older groups.


Behind the standards we find considerable and shocking country distinctions. In markets with a strong analysis tradition, such as Finland and the UK, around eight in ten still choose to check out online news, yet in India and Thailand, around 4 in 10 (40%) say they favor to watch information online, and in the important source Philippines that percentage is over half (52%).


In numerous Eastern nations, populaces tend to be younger, mobile data tend to be fairly low-cost, and video news is widely available via platforms such as YouTube and TikTok. In Thailand, for example, higher opportunities for freedom of speech online have actually resulted in the production of a wave of independent TV-style online reveals that are widely taken in on cellphones.
